**Yoon Suk-yeol remains in custody with multiple convictions carrying lengthy or life sentences, and appeals have not produced any release as of September 2026.** South Korea’s former president was convicted of insurrection for his December 2024 martial law declaration and sentenced to life imprisonment in February 2026; separate rulings added a 30-year term for alleged drone operations over North Korea and upheld a seven-year sentence by the Supreme Court in July for procedural violations and resisting arrest. He has faced re-arrest warrants and ongoing detention amid several parallel trials. Recent September 2026 acquittals on narrower perjury and abuse-of-power charges in related matters have not altered the core convictions or detention status. With the current date leaving only months until 2027 and no scheduled events or executive actions indicating imminent release or pardon, trader consensus reflects the structural barriers posed by finalized or upheld sentences and the pace of South Korea’s appeals process.

If Yoon is released but remains under house arrest, the market will still resolve to "Yes".
If Yoon is released on parole, bond, or any other condition that results in them leaving state custody, the market will resolve to "Yes".
Transporting Yoon to another location of custody (e.g., a different prison, court, or hospital within the correctional system) will not suffice to resolve this market to "Yes".
The primary resolution source for this market will be official information from government authorities or corrections departments; however, a consensus of credible reporting may also be used.
